Summary

The job is for a Solutions Engineer at Darktrace's Go-to-Market team, a remote role for a French-speaking individual. The role involves technical leadership, qualifying and driving new business opportunities, collaborating with the sales team, establishing trust as a technical authority, conducting demonstrations of Darktrace technology, and planning client-specific deployment strategies.

Requirements

  • 3+ years in a software sales engineering role; experience in cybersecurity is preferred
  • Proficiency in technical language with an ability to simplify complex concepts and communicate them effectively to various audiences
  • Strong knowledge in both on-premises and cloud networking and technologies. Familiarity with full cybersecurity stack and attack methodologies preferred
  • Exceptional interpersonal skills with strong written and verbal communication abilities for a client facing role
  • Ability to operate independently, manage multiple projects simultaneously, and work collaboratively within a fast-paced, innovative team
  • Passion for staying updated with the latest cybersecurity trends and a willingness to continuously develop your skillset
  • Masterโ€™s or bachelorโ€™s from an accredited university
  • Bilingual in French and English

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the technical lead between clients, partners, and internal teams at Darktrace
  • Qualify, prioritize, and drive new business opportunities in coordination with an account team
  • Collaborate with the Sales team to identify client needs, implement effective sales strategies, and communicate deployment proposals
  • Establish yourself as a trusted advisor and technical authority to clients, from technical staff to C-suite executives
  • Conduct Proof of Value demonstrations of Darktrace technology, where appropriate
  • Plan and design client-specific deployment strategies and architectures in varying coverage areas
  • Travel regionally, and potentially internationally, to client sites as permitted by health guidelines
